[Plone-IT] Usare i vocabolari in plone

Yuri yurj a alfa.it
Lun 10 Set 2012 13:46:44 UTC


Il 10/09/2012 15:36, plonista ha scritto:
> ehm, perņ se volessi pescare una sottocartella del vocabolario come potrei
> fare?
>
> se faccio:
> animali = voc.getVocabularyByName('vocabolario1/vocabolario2')
> non trova nulla
> lo stesso se punto direttamente mettendo il nome del secondo vocabolario
> figlio del primo:
> animali = voc.getVocabularyByName('vocabolario2')

voc = getToolByName(self.portal, 'portal_vocabularies')
vocabolario= voc.getVocabularyByName('nomevocabolario')
animali = vocabolario.vocabolario2 o animali = vocabolario['vocabolario2'] oppure felini = = vocabolario['vocabolario2']['felini']

Cioé una volta ottenuta la radice con voc.getVocabularyByName, il resto 
segue le solite regole python per i dizionari e attributi (o quasi)

>
>
>
>
>
> --
> View this message in context: http://plone-regional-forums.221720.n2.nabble.com/Usare-i-vocabolari-in-plone-tp7580914p7580938.html
> Sent from the Plone - Italy mailing list archive at Nabble.com.
> _______________________________________________
> Plone-IT mailing list
> Plone-IT a lists.plone.org
> https://lists.plone.org/mailman/listinfo/plone-plone-it
> http://plone-regional-forums.221720.n2.nabble.com/Plone-Italy-f221721.html



Maggiori informazioni sulla lista Plone-IT